How the Calculator Works

The calculation is based on the fundamental volumetric flow rate formula:

                                                 Q = V / t

Symbols

  • Q = Volume flow rate
  • V = Volume transferred
  • t = Time

Example Calculation

Suppose water flows at a rate of 50 liters per minute (L/min) for 2 hours.

  1. Convert time: 2 hours = 120 minutes

  2. Multiply: V = 50 × 120 = 6000 liters

  3. Convert to cubic meters: 6000 ÷ 1000 = 6 m³

So, a pump delivering 50 L/min over 2 hours will transfer 6 cubic meters of water.

Applications of Flow Rate to Volume Conversion

  • Water Supply Systems – Estimate how much water is supplied over time
  • Pumping Calculations – Determine tank filling or emptying time
  • Process Engineering – Track batch volumes in chemical plants
  • Oil & Gas – Calculate crude oil or gas transferred in pipelines
  • HVAC Systems – Measure chilled water or air volume flow over time
